February 21, 1806.
RAN AWAY from Pembroke coffee-mountain, in St. Mary,
some time since, a creole negro, named DICKY, about forty
years old, supposed to be harboured in the neighbourhood of
Port-Antonio: Also, DAVY, a Mungola, a stout negro, about
thirty-five years old. Half-a-Joe reward for each will be paid
on delivering them to the above property, or securing them in
any workhouse.
